What are some red flags when hiring a handyman in New Orleans?

Be cautious of New Orleans handymen who can't provide references or proof of insurance, or who give vague estimates, especially for historic homes. High-pressure sales tactics or demands for full payment upfront are also warning signs. Always ensure they are licensed and insured for your protection.
